Understanding E-Cigarettes
E-cigarettes are designed to simulate the act of smoking but typically contain fewer harmful substances than traditional cigarettes. They feature a mechanism that heats a liquid, often referred to as ‘vape juice’ or ‘e-liquid,’ which usually consists of nicotine, flavorings, and a base such as propylene glycol or vegetable glycerin. These substances are generally recognized as safe for consumption, but their effects when vaporized and inhaled require further examination.
The Role of Ingredients
Among the ingredients in e-liquids, propylene glycol and vegetable glycerin are known to potentially irritate the respiratory system. Propylene glycol can lead to throat dryness and a tickling sensation, which may elicit coughing. As users continue vaping, the constant exposure might exacerbate the irritation, resulting in a chronic cough. Vegetable glycerin is less irritating but contributes to producing thicker vapor, which some find difficult to inhale, potentially leading to coughing.
Nicotine’s Impact
Although many e-cigarette users reduce their nicotine intake, it’s essential to note that nicotine itself can be a cough trigger. It has a bronchoconstrictive effect, which means that it narrows the air passages in the lungs, potentially leading to coughing. Furthermore, higher concentrations of nicotine can intensify throat irritation, prompting a persistent cough among users.

Switching Too Quickly
Another consideration is the abrupt switch to e-cigarettes from traditional smoking. The body needs time to adapt to new substances and inhalation methods. Users might find that a gradual transition allows their respiratory system to acclimate, reducing bouts of coughing. A sudden change can shock the system, possibly resulting in a persistent cough.
Minimizing Coughing Episodes
To counteract coughing from e-cigarettes, users might consider adjusting their vaping techniques. Taking slower, shorter inhalations can minimize irritation. Additionally, varying the nicotine strength and experimenting with different e-liquids can identify which combinations trigger the least coughing, ensuring a more pleasant experience.
